Editorial note: The answers are editorial distillations based on the interview and on his book A Billion Years of Sex Differences.
Does evolutionary psychology say that behaviour is biologically fixed?
No. An evolutionary origin does not necessarily mean a trait is fixed forever. Genes may push development in certain directions, but they are not the only influences. Learning, culture, incentives, and institutions also matter. The claim is not that biology alone is destiny. The claim is that biology is part of the causal story.
Does explaining a behaviour excuse it?
No. Explanation and justification are different things. Evolutionary psychology may help explain sex differences in aggression, jealousy, sexual behaviour, and parental care. But an explanation does not tell us whether a behaviour or sex difference is morally desirable. “Natural” does not necessarily mean “good.” Why would it?
Are most psychological sex differences huge?
No. In our species, at least, most psychological sex differences are statistical differences with substantial overlap. Men and women may differ on average, but many women score higher than many men on so-called male-typical traits, and many men score higher than many women on so-called female-typical traits. Average differences are not rules about individuals.
What is a “fuzzy” sex difference?
A fuzzy or statistical sex difference is a difference in group averages, not a clean division. For example, one sex may have a higher average on a trait, while the two distributions still overlap heavily. Most human sex differences fall into this category, rather than into a simple “men are like this, women are like that” pattern – or even a “most men are like this, most women are like that” pattern.
What kinds of sex differences does the book discuss?
The book discusses physical, developmental, psychological, behavioural, and mental-health sex differences. Examples include differences in size and strength, the timing of puberty, life expectancy, sexual orientation, interest in casual sex, mate preferences, aggression, risk-taking, childcare, things-oriented versus people-oriented interests, spatial versus verbal abilities, childhood play and toy preferences, ADHD, autism, substance abuse, depression, anxiety, and eating disorders.
Are evolutionary-psychology hypotheses unfalsifiable?
No. This is a common misconception. Evolutionary hypotheses are falsifiable, and many have been falsified, including some of Stewart-Williams’s own hypotheses.
What is one example of a falsified evolutionary hypothesis?
One example discussed in the interview is E. O. Wilson’s kin-selection hypothesis about same-sex sexual orientation. The idea was that people with a same-sex orientation help boost their relatives’ reproductive success, rather than their own, thus indirectly passing on the genes giving rise to their sexual orientation through the relatives. Researchers tested the idea, and the verdict is that it does not seem to explain same-sex sexual orientation in humans.
What about the ovulatory-shift or “good genes” hypothesis?
The dual-mating or ovulatory-shift hypothesis holds that women sometimes seek investment from one kind of man and “good genes” from another, with preferences shifting around ovulation. In the interview, Stewart-Williams called it an interesting hypothesis and said the debate is not completely closed. But he also said he currently is much more persuaded by critics who argue that the evidence has not borne it out.
Does socialisation explain sex differences?
It explains some things, but not everything. Socialisation clearly matters, as do stereotypes and culture. But it is not sufficient as a complete explanation. Several points count against nurture-only accounts: some differences appear early in development or in the wake of puberty; many appear across cultures; some are linked to prenatal hormones; some resemble patterns in other species; and some grow rather than shrink in more gender-equal countries.
What is the gender-equality paradox?
The gender-equality paradox is the finding that many sex differences are larger, not smaller, in wealthier, more individualistic, more gender-equal countries. Stewart-Williams treats this as a problem for simple patriarchy explanations or explanations based on societal sex roles.
Are stereotypes always false?
No. Following Lee Jussim, Stewart-Williams argues that stereotypes can sometimes track social reality. That does not mean stereotypes are always accurate, harmless, or morally acceptable. They can exaggerate or minimize differences, become self-fulfilling to some degree, or encourage unfair treatment of individuals. But the mere fact that a belief is a stereotype does not prove that it is false.
Can acknowledging average differences reduce stereotyping?
Possibly. Nikil Mukerji raised the point that stating average differences need not always make people conform to them. It could sometimes have the opposite effect: if people know the average tendency, they may consciously decide not to follow it. Stewart-Williams accepted the possibility. The responsible position is to acknowledge average differences while encouraging individuality.
How can denying sex differences harm mental health care?
If sex differences in psychological disorders are ignored, clinicians and ordinary people may miss problems in the less affected sex. In the interview and the book, examples include ADHD and autism, which may be overlooked in girls because the standard descriptions of these disorders fit boys better (autism less often involves repetitive behaviour in girls, for instance). Another example is depression, which may be overlooked in men because the standard description fits women better (in men, depression more often involves anger, aggression, or substance use, for example).
How can denying sex differences distort public policy?
If average differences in interests are ignored, occupational gaps may be treated as if they were entirely caused by discrimination. Stewart-Williams argues that this can misdirect resources, create resentment, and justify coercive policies. Bias exists, but it is rarely the whole explanation. A good policy diagnosis has to ask how much of a gap is due to bias, how much to interests and lifestyle preferences, and how much to other factors.
Does affirmative action have possible costs?
Stewart-Williams argues that it can. If positions are reserved for one sex, or if a less qualified candidate is chosen to achieve numerical parity, the policy may reverse discrimination rather than eliminate it. It may also cast doubt on the competence of the supposedly benefited group and increase impostor feelings among beneficiaries. This is presented as a risk of some policies, not as a claim that every affirmative-action policy is unjustified.
What does “sex” mean biologically?
In the book, Stewart-Williams uses the gamete definition, which has been the standard scientific definition since the late 1800s. Females are organised around the production of large gametes, eggs; males are organised around the production of small gametes, sperm. Chromosomes, genitals, hormones, and secondary sex traits are connected to sex, but they do not define it.
Why be skeptical of the term “gender”?
Because it has too many meanings. Sometimes it means sex. Sometimes it means masculinity or femininity. Sometimes it means social roles, stereotypes, gender identity, personality profiles, or differences supposedly caused by nurture. Stewart-Williams argues that this ambiguity makes the term less useful for science. If one means sex, one should say sex. If one means personality, one should say personality. If one means social roles, one should say social roles. In addition, many definitions of gender have serious problems of their own.
What is the responsible position on sex differences?
The responsible position is neither denial nor exaggeration. Stewart-Williams argues for telling the truth carefully: acknowledge average differences where the evidence supports them; emphasise overlap and individuality; reject the naturalistic fallacy; avoid treating averages as prescriptions; and give every individual a fair chance.
